#bdfe93 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bdfe93 is composed of 74.1% red, 99.6%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 96.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 78.6%. #bdfe93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7bfd27.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#bdfe93

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030900 is the darkest color, while #f8fff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bdfe93

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8ccc5 is the less saturated color, while #bdfe93 is the most saturated one.
